Fort Mac sweeps Swift Current

by Giants Insider

Make it two in a row for the Fort McMurray Giants as they sweep the Swift Current 57's in a rain shortened affair on Thursday night.

The cool weather and rain couldn't slow the Giants as they picked up where they left off in their previous game against the 57's. In the third inning, Shortstop Darcy Barry jump starts the offense again, this time with a triple off the centerfield fence before scoring on a wild pitch. Oklahoma Baptist teammates, Jayden Shafer and Jaden Wiley draw a walk each to restart the rally, Shafer scoring on a RBI single from Catcher Benicio Diaz to make it 2-0 Giants. 

The fourth started with a loud out as Manny Alberto lined out to the warning track through the rain. Junho Son and Darcy Barry reached base via a walk and hit-by-pitch before the Giants struck with two, two out clutch RBI singles from Michael Buckley and Jaden Wiley to extend the lead to 5-0.

Giants Starting Pitcher Bryn Biemiller battled the elements all night and found a way to overcome a lengthy rain delay to seal the deal for the Giants. Biemiller, a super-Senior from Lourdes University tossed a (rain shortened) complete game scattering two hits, while striking out five Swift Current batters to move to 2-0 on the year. 

The Giants continue their road swing in Moose Jaw on Friday night as they take on the Miller Express at Ross Wells Stadium beginning at 7:05pm.
